If you haven’t read it yet go to the library or buy a copy of Robert Allen’s Nothing Down to start you off.

If you are starting out and need info to help you figure out the basics go with Bronchick-such as his Nuts and Bolts course. If it is lease options you want, all on your list except Gatten offer l/o courses-although Kaiser’s is more of an intermediate level course. Gatten has his own creation(PACTrust)which you may want to order his book on for about $15 to get some basics on before going for the course.

You may want to start out at the library with some books first to help you find your area of interest. Wade Cook,Robert Shemin,William Nickerson,James Lumley are some authors to look for. When you find your area of interest then you can get to the detailed material on that area-for example fixer uppers are covered by Kevin Myers among others. Nolo Press(www.nolo.com) has a lot of self help legal real estate materials to check out for landlording among other needs. If you do lease options like it sounds like you will judging from the authors you mention above get a copy of Nolo’s “Every Landlord’s Legal Guide” as well as “Landlording” by Leigh Robinson.

You can also use the search function at the top of the page to look for “books” to help you out.
